About Glypo Oral Solution

Glypo Oral Solution is a medicine used to treat ongoing constipation and to clear the digestive tract completely before medical tests or surgeries. It works by bringing water into your bowel, which softens your stool and makes bowel movements more frequent and easier to pass. This helps ensure your intestines are completely clear for diagnostic procedures like colonoscopies.

To get the best results, you must take the Glypo Oral Solution exactly as directed by your doctor. If you are taking it for daily constipation, consistency is key, and you should take it at the same time each day, with or without food. Along with taking this medicine, drinking plenty of water, eating fiber-rich foods, and staying physically active can significantly improve your digestive health.

While taking Glypo Oral Solution , some people may experience mild stomach discomfort, bloating, or nausea. These symptoms are usually temporary, but if you experience severe vomiting, severe abdominal pain, or blood in your stool, you should contact your doctor immediately.

Do not take this if you have a bowel obstruction, a tear in your stomach or intestinal wall, or severe inflammatory bowel conditions. Always talk to your doctor before starting Glypo Oral Solution if you have kidney problems, heart conditions, or a history of salt imbalances in your blood.

Because Glypo Oral Solution works by flushing your bowel, it can prevent other oral medicines from being absorbed properly if taken at the same time. Talk to your doctor or pharmacist if you take blood pressure medications, or if you are pregnant, breastfeeding, or elderly, to ensure you can use this medicine safely.

Uses of Glypo Oral Solution

Glypo Oral Solution is used to relieve constipation and cleanse the bowel before certain medical procedures. The detailed uses are as follows:

  • Chronic constipation: Glypo Oral Solution helps by drawing water into the bowel to soften dry, hard stool, making it much easier to pass.
  • Bowel cleansing before medical procedures: Glypo Oral Solution clears out the digestive tract completely so that doctors can get a clear view during examinations like colonoscopies or X-rays.

Directions for Use

  • Glypo Oral Solution can be taken with or without food, or as advised by your doctor.
  • Follow your doctor's instructions on the dosage and timing of this medication.
  • Check the label for directions. Dilute Glypo Oral Solution with water as advised by your doctor. Take it orally using the measuring cup provided with the package.
  • Shake the bottle well before each use.

How Glypo Oral Solution Works

Glypo Oral Solution contains polyethylene glycol, potassium chloride, sodium bicarbonate, and sodium chloride, which work together to relieve constipation and cleanse the bowel while maintaining the body's fluid and electrolyte balance. Polyethylene glycol is an osmotic agent that binds to water and carries it into the colon, where it softens hard stools, increases stool volume, and stimulates natural bowel movements. Potassium chloride, sodium bicarbonate, and sodium chloride replace essential electrolytes that may be lost during bowel cleansing, helping maintain hydration and normal electrolyte levels. Together, these ingredients provide effective bowel cleansing while reducing the risk of dehydration and electrolyte imbalance.

What if I have taken an overdose of Glypo Oral Solution

If you take more than the recommended dose of Glypo Oral Solution , seek immediate medical attention. Symptoms of an overdose may include severe diarrhoea, dehydration, or electrolyte imbalance.

Diet & Lifestyle Advise

  • Stay well hydrated: Drink plenty of clear fluids, such as water, clear broths, or herbal teas, especially when using Glypo Oral Solution for bowel preparation.
  • Increase dietary fibre: If treating constipation, gradually include more fruits, vegetables, and whole grains in your diet to support regular bowel movements.
  • Stay physically active: Engage in light exercise, such as daily walking, to help stimulate natural bowel function.
  • Avoid gas-producing foods and drinks: Limit carbonated beverages and foods that commonly cause bloating or excess gas.

What if you forget to take Glypo Oral Solution

If you are taking Glypo Oral Solution daily for constipation and miss a dose, take it as soon as you remember. If it is almost time for your next dose, skip the missed one and continue with your regular schedule. Do not take a double dose to make up for a missed one. If you are preparing for a medical procedure and miss a dose or fall behind on your drinking schedule, contact your doctor or the clinic immediately for guidance.

Storage

•Store the unmixed powder at 15°C to 30°C in a cool, dry place away from heat, direct light, and moisture. Do not store it in the bathroom.

Drug Warnings

  • Check the prepared solution: Drink the solution only if it is clear and free of undissolved powder. Do not use it if it appears cloudy or discoloured.
  • Do not alter the solution: Do not add sugar, flavourings, or thickeners, as they may affect how Glypo Oral Solution works.
  • Chill before use: Refrigerating the prepared solution may improve its taste. Do not freeze it.
  • Manage bloating: If you develop severe abdominal bloating or distension, slow down or temporarily stop drinking the solution until the symptoms improve.
  • Special dietary restrictions: Consult your doctor before using Glypo Oral Solution if you are on a sodium-restricted or potassium-restricted diet.

FAQs

Glypo Oral Solution belongs to a class of drugs called laxatives, used to treat constipation.
Glypo Oral Solution contains Polyethylene glycol, Potassium chloride, Sodium bicarbonate and Sodium chloride. Polyethylene glycol draws water into the intestine and softens stools, making it easier to pass. Potassium chloride is essential for the healthy functioning of organs. Sodium bicarbonate works by neutralising high levels of acid in the stomach, helping to treat acidity and heartburn. Sodium chloride maintains sodium levels in the body. Together, Glypo Oral Solution helps in relieving constipation.
Glypo Oral Solution may cause mild diarrhoea as a side effect at the beginning of the treatment. It usually gets better by reducing the amount of Glypo Oral Solution intake. However, if the condition persists or worsens, please consult a doctor.
You are not recommended to take Glypo Oral Solution with anticonvulsants as it may reduce the effectiveness of anticonvulsants (medicines for epilepsy). However, please consult your doctor before taking Glypo Oral Solution with other medicines.
You are recommended to avoid foods that are high in fat and low in fibre, such as ice cream, red meat, frozen meals, potato chips, cheese, hot dogs and hamburgers.
You are not recommended to take more than the advised dose of Glypo Oral Solution as it may cause excessive diarrhoea that might lead to dehydration. If you have diarrhoea, stop taking Glypo Oral Solution and drink plenty of fluids to avoid dehydration. However, if the condition persists or worsens, please consult a doctor.
It is best to dissolve the powder only in water as directed on the package. Mixing it with juice, soda, or other drinks can alter the concentration of salts and affect how the medicine works. Talk to your doctor or pharmacist before adding anything to the solution.
If you are taking Glypo Oral Solution to cleanse your bowel before a medical procedure, you must avoid solid foods and only consume clear liquids. If you are taking it for daily constipation, you can eat normally. Talk to your doctor for specific dietary guidelines.
Since Glypo Oral Solution is minimally absorbed by the body, it is generally considered safe, but you should always talk to your doctor before taking any laxative during pregnancy or breastfeeding.
If you feel nauseous, try drinking the solution more slowly or take a brief break of 15 to 30 minutes before resuming. Drinking the solution chilled can also help reduce nausea. Talk to your doctor if the nausea is severe or if you vomit.
Mild stomach cramps and bloating are common side effects as the medicine works to move stool through your bowels. However, if you experience severe, sharp, or persistent stomach pain, stop taking the medicine and contact your doctor immediately.
Glypo Oral Solution can prevent other oral medicines from being absorbed properly because it speeds up bowel movements. You should take your other oral medications at least 1 hour before or 1 hour after taking Glypo Oral Solution . Talk to your doctor or pharmacist to plan your medication schedule safely.
Your bowel preparation is typically complete when your bowel movements become clear, yellowish, and free of solid matter. If your stool is still dark or contains solid particles near the time of your procedure, contact your doctor's clinic for advice.
